It takes 8 minutes for Byron to fill the kiddie pool in the backyard using only a handheld hose. When his younger sister is impatient, Byron also uses the lawn sprinkler to add water to the pool so it is filled more quickly. If the hose and sprinkler are used together, it takes 5 minutes to fill the pool. Which equation can be used to determine r, the rate in parts per minute, at which the lawn sprinkler would fill the pool if used alone?

A. 5/8 + 5r = 8
B. 5/8 + 5r = 1
C. 5(5/8) = r
D. 5/8 = 5r
